Description
Key Features
Examines the spiritual tensions that help explain the political conduct of Israel.
Analyzes the region as a meeting point for superpowers and Arab nationalism.
Provides historical context regarding the religious authority versus secular democracy.
Offers insight into the conflicts impacting world peace and global stability.
Part of the Routledge Library Editions focused on Israel and Palestine studies.
